Über uns

Nestled in the Kumaon region of the Indian Himalayan state of Uttarakhand, Avani is a community built on the principles of sustainability and local empowerment. A global network of diverse employees, interns and volunteers give life to Avani’s community-centric rural development programs.
In a region where small farms are many families only source of income, Avani is a hub of opportunity; constantly developing new approaches to sustainable, conservation-based livelihood generation for rural communities.
The name “Avani” comes from the Hindi word for Earth. Avani creates opportunities for rural women and men to find viable employment through a self-sufficient and environmentally sustainable supply chain. Every business decision related to Avani products is guided by a strong responsibility toward environmental best practices and sensitivity to the cultural context of the villages where we work.
Avani was founded in 1997, originally as the Kumaon chapter of the Barefoot College. In 1999, Avani was formally registered as a non-profit organization.

Our approach
Avani creates a lasting shift in the socio-economic fabric of rural villages. Our holistic approach to employment opportunities ensures sustainable livelihoods for women and families, resilient communities and vibrant ecosystems.
At Avani, the process of production is as important as the products themselves. We combine traditional knowledge and craft with a modern approach to production and distribution. We take a triple bottom line approach to address Economy, Ecology and Empowerment. We use local resources to create contemporary products and services for a global market.
The cornerstones of our work have always been environmental conservation, women’s empowerment, fair trade and preservation of traditional knowledge.
Our projects are inspired by and tailored to the unique topography, resources and culture of this Central Himalayan region. Building on local knowledge and practices, Avani puts naturally available resources to use in innovative ways in collaboration with local people.

Programmes
• Clean Energy: We are working on several clean energy technologies including solar energy for rural homes and charcoal as a clean cooking fuel for rural households. These solutions not only provide clean energy, but also contribute to enhancing biodiversity, a major contributor to reducing carbon emissions.
• Textiles: Natural materials, local skills, and technologies for contemporary products
• Lifestyle Products: Hand crafted pigments, dyes, and supplies for health and happiness
• Farm Based Activites: Organic harvests and sustainable practices to generate income all year long.
• Water Management: Responsible, renewable rainwater harvesting
• Abhivyakti School: A destination for fun and self-expression where children learn to be themselves. In April 2011 a small creative learning center based on a child-friendly learning model was set up at the Avani campus and has been running successfully since.
